ADVERTISEMENT FOR BIDS

1. BIDS for the furnishing of the necessary materials and construction of the DIVISION STREET BOX CULVERT REPAIR FOR THE CITY OF HUDSON, OHIO will be received through the Bid Express website at https://www.bidexpress.com/ until 9:30 AM, LOCAL TIME, TUESDAY, NOVEMBER 4, 2025.  The City of Hudson will open and publicly read the total bid amount for bids via video-teleconference.

2. The proposed work includes the removal of a section of failed box culvert lid along Division Street, installing a new reinforced concrete slab in its place, and restoring the pavement in the City of Hudson, Ohio, in accordance with the specifications which are on file in the office of the City Engineer.

3. The City will only receive Bids through the Bid Express website at https://www.bidexpress.com . All bid forms, contract documents and plans are available through the Bid Express website.  A fee of $50 will be incurred to bid electronically on a pay-per solicitation basis; alternatively, you may subscribe for $60 per month to have access to all solicitations and email notifications.

4. Bids must be accompanied by Bid security in the form of either a Bid Guaranty and Contract Bond for the full amount of the bid, or a certified check, cashier’s check, or letter of credit pursuant to Chapter 1305 of the ORC, in the amount of 10% of the bid, made payable to the City of Hudson.

5. In the case of disruption of national communications or loss of services by Bid Express within two hours prior to the deadline for submission of bids, the City will delay the deadline for bid submissions to ensure the ability of potential bidders to submit bids.  If this occurs, instructions will be communicated to potential bidders.

6. The City of Hudson, Ohio reserves the right to reject any or all Bids, and to waive any nonconformities not involving price, time, or changes in the work.
